About Choghadiya
Choghadiya is a Vedic Hindu method of dividing the day and night into eight equal parts. Each Choghadiya has a specific quality that determines whether it is auspicious or inauspicious for starting new works.
- Amrit: Most auspicious - good for all works
- Shubh: Auspicious - good for important works
- Labh: Profitable - good for business & financial matters
- Char: Movable - good for travel & journey
- Rog: Inauspicious - avoid important works
- Kaal: Inauspicious - avoid starting new works
- Udveg: Stressful - avoid important decisions
